20.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from Ahmad ibn Muhammad in a marfu‘ manner who has said the following
“Ab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), has said, ‘It is permissible to pay Zakat al-Fitrah to a slave who has contracted his freedom, slave of one’s wife, his own Christian, Zoroastrian slave and those who have closed the door on themselves.’”
20ـ م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 يَحْيَى ع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 أَحْمَدَ رَفَعَهُ عَنْ أَبِي عَبْدِ الله (عَلَيْهِ السَّلاَم) قَالَ
يُؤَدِّي الرَّجُلُ زَكَاةَ الْفِطْرَةِ عَنْ مُكَاتَبِهِ وَرَقِيقِ امْرَأَتِهِ وَعَبْدِهِ النَّصْرَانِيِّ وَالْمَجُوسِيِّ وَمَا أَغْلَقَ عَلَيْهِ بَابَهُ.
